Nonstick cookware on the chopping block in California

California lawmakers have advanced a bill to ban the sale of nonstick cookware and corded kitchen appliances that contain PFAS (forever chemicals) despite strong opposition from an industry group that insists the products are save. Bill 682 would phase out a range of consumer products in the state – along with many commercial products, that contain any amount of “intentionally …[continue reading]
